Springtail: Springtails (Order Collembola) are small primitive hexapods whose chief ecological function are as scavengers. Often they are quite abundant in their habitat, numbering in the millions of individuals per acre. [100%] 2023-01-26
Springtail: Springtails (Collembola) form the largest of the three lineages of modern hexapods that are no longer considered insects (the other two are the Protura and Diplura).
